Output 7d5985563b302fef9a4b6ce223300d89a4eb4e6294b0f83a5efbaeab2a5960ad:1

value
16557688
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2705d02fb3c18db3a14426c88a3c19369c79ef8c OP_EQUAL
address
35FMEwCamDkmsUqsFLcRzyji2k3fY56Zs8
transaction
7d5985563b302fef9a4b6ce223300d89a4eb4e6294b0f83a5efbaeab2a5960ad
confirmations
346766
spent
true